Essay: Law Abiding Citizen (2009)
Law Abiding Citizen (2009) is a tense, morally complex thriller that explores justice, vengeance, and the flaws of the legal system. Directed by F. Gary Gray and written by Kurt Wimmer, the film centers on two opposing forces: Clyde Shelton, a man driven to extreme measures after a brutal personal tragedy, and Nick Rice, an ambitious prosecutor who must confront the consequences of pragmatic legal decisions.
Plot and Structure The narrative begins with a home invasion in which Clyde’s wife and young daughter are murdered. When the legal system fails to deliver what Clyde perceives as true justice—because a plea deal spares one of the killers in exchange for testimony—the grieving husband becomes radicalized. Rather than simply seeking retribution against the two perpetrators, Clyde launches a methodical campaign targeting everyone connected to the case, especially the prosecutors, judges, and law-enforcement officials he holds responsible for the system’s compromises.
The film unfolds in a cat-and-mouse structure. Initially, it appears to be a straightforward revenge story, but it broadens into a calculated assault on the institutions of law: Clyde stages elaborate murders and traps that expose procedural weaknesses and media vulnerability. Nick Rice, the prosecutor who cut the deal years earlier to secure convictions, is forced into a gruelling moral and tactical struggle. The stakes escalate as Clyde anticipates legal loopholes and public reactions, using both psychological warfare and technological cunning to manipulate the system from within prison.
Themes and Moral Questions At its core, Law Abiding Citizen interrogates the difference between legal justice and moral justice. It asks whether outcomes that respect constitutional safeguards and plea bargaining can still be morally unsatisfactory for victims’ families. Clyde embodies a visceral critique: when the law prioritizes efficiency or convictions over proportional accountability, can an individual justify taking justice into their own hands?
The film also examines the ethics of decision-making within the justice system. Nick Rice’s career-driven plea bargains highlight systemic incentives—career prosecutors may opt for guaranteed convictions rather than risk trial losses. Gray and Wimmer probe whether sacrificing ideal justice for practical results corrupts the system’s legitimacy. This tension raises uncomfortable questions about the balance between due process, victims’ rights, public safety, and the personal cost of compromise.
Characters and Performances Gerard Butler’s portrayal of Clyde Shelton is chilling and layered: at once charismatic, controlled, and terrifying. Butler channels a restrained rage that makes Clyde both sympathetic and monstrous. Jamie Foxx’s Nick Rice serves as the film’s moral foil—smooth, pragmatic, and at first unsentimental. Foxx balances a public-facing political persona with private guilt and vulnerability as Clyde’s campaign escalates.
Supporting performances, including Leslie Bibb and Colm Meaney, flesh out the legal and investigative world. The dynamic between Butler and Foxx—personalized yet emblematic of larger institutional conflict—drives the movie’s emotional and ethical core.
Style and Direction F. Gary Gray stages the film with a polished, commercially attuned style. The pacing is propulsive; the screenplay reveals plot twists and carefully orchestrated set pieces that sustain tension. The film’s thriller mechanics—suspenseful reveals, traps, and confrontations—are balanced with quieter scenes that interrogate motives and consequences. Cinematography and editing favor clarity and momentum, while the score amplifies the mounting dread and moral impatience central to the story.
Critique and Reception Law Abiding Citizen received mixed critical responses. Many praised Butler’s performance, the film’s energy, and its provocative premise. Critics often noted, however, that the movie occasionally lapses into implausibility: Clyde’s far-reaching capacity to manipulate events and the legal system strains credulity. Some reviewers felt the film simplifies complex legal realities for dramatic effect, turning nuanced ethical debates into binary confrontations. Others objected to the finale’s moral positioning, arguing the film flirts with endorsement of vigilante methods even as it condemns them.
Cultural and Legal Resonance The film taps into perennial anxieties about crime, punishment, and institutional failure—issues that resonate in societies grappling with high-profile cases, plea bargaining controversies, and perceptions of uneven justice. Law Abiding Citizen acts as a cultural mirror, reflecting fears that legal pragmatism can betray victims and that the system’s architecture can be exploited by those with motive and intelligence.
Conclusion Law Abiding Citizen is a provocative, suspenseful thriller that forces viewers to confront uncomfortable questions about justice and retribution. Anchored by strong central performances and a relentless narrative drive, it succeeds as entertainment while provoking debate about how societies should balance legal procedure with moral accountability. Though it sometimes sacrifices realism for dramatic effect, the film’s willingness to dramatize the moral costs of a compromised justice system gives it lasting thematic interest.
